The Erzsébet-liget of Újszeged is the largest park in Szeged. Due to its size and variety of species and age-based wooded vegetation, it is a prominent bird habitat within the city. The Csongrád County Local Group of the Hungarian Bird and Nature Conservation Association (MME) has been monitoring the natural values of the area for decades.

In the place of today's grove, it used to be a booming precinct, adapted in the late 1800s. It is still surrounded by giant platforms with lawn clearings, with old linden, oak and maple. The area was significantly modified in 2018. The landscape architects also included the local group of MME Csongrád County, as besides the other goals, it was important to maintain and expand the bird-friendly function of the grove. In this context, 3 bird-waterers, 2 large guillotines and 50 new lairs were placed in addition to the existing 25.
